BALD people in East Lancashire have been invited to take part in the first British clinical trial for laser-assisted hair transplantation.

Up to 50 men with a male-pattern bald patch are being sought by husband-and-wife team Doctors Bessam and Nilofer Farjo, who run the Farjo Medical Centre of Advanced Hair Technology in Manchester and London.

They want to assess the value of grafting by laser compared to conventional scalpel techniques.
